The Culinary Institute of America (CIA)
The Culinary Institute of America (CIA) is a private, not-for-profit culinary college founded in 1946 in New Haven, Connecticut, to train returning World War II veterans in the culinary arts. It later moved its main campus to Hyde Park, New York, and became one of the best-known culinary schools in the United States.
